Phone number βοΈ 00211160010242 π is reported as a scam involving quick missed calls that ring once or twice then hang up, often from international numbers linked to South Sudan. Callers should not return these calls as doing so may connect them to premium rate services that incur very high charges, which scammers then profit from. This "wangiri" fraud uses automated systems to trick people into calling back, leading to expensive bills. Multiple users confirm receiving such calls and emphasise not answering or returning them. The fraud is sophisticated, targeting many people at once to exploit phone credit or bill payments. Overall, itβs a scam designed to steal money through deceptive one-ring calls and is considered a nuisance and costly trap by many affected.
